7. NMFS REGIONAL CHIEF URGES CONSENSUS BUILDING

By presenting a united front, the region increases the chances that
its voice will be heard when it comes time to make key decisions regarding
management of the Columbia River Basin, says Will Stelle, Northwest regional
administrator for the National Marine Fisheries Service. NMFS, in a 1995
biological opinion, specified that changes in operations for the federal
Columbia-Snake river hydroelectric system are necessary to improve in-river
